We Will Never Forget

September carries a weight that time has not erased. This year marks 25 years since the attacks of September 11, 2001-a day remembered for unimaginable loss, profound grief, extraordinary courage, and countless acts of compassion.

For many, the images remain painfully vivid. Families lost loved ones, communities were shaken, and people around the world watched events unfold that would change history. Behind every number was a human life-a parent, child, spouse, friend, colleague, neighbor. As we remember, our first responsibility is to honor them with dignity.

In this September 2026 issue of Christian Times Magazine, we reflect not only on tragedy, but also on the enduring Christian call to remember, pray, serve, and pursue peace.

Scripture reminds us, "Blessed are those who mourn, for they will be comforted" (Matthew 5:4). Twenty-five years later, there are families for whom the grief remains deeply personal. We remember them in prayer. We also honor the firefighters, police officers, emergency workers, medical personnel, military members, clergy, volunteers, and ordinary citizens who responded with remarkable courage and selflessness.

Remembering September 11 should do more than take us back to a painful moment. It should challenge us to consider how we live today. In a world still marked by conflict, fear, division, and hatred, followers of Christ are called to be people of reconciliation, compassion, truth, and hope.

Our faith does not ask us to ignore suffering. It teaches us to enter the places of sorrow carrying the light of Christ. It calls us to love our neighbors, comfort those who mourn, reject hatred, defend human dignity, and become peacemakers wherever God has placed us.

As you read this commemorative issue, may these pages encourage reflection on the lives that were lost, gratitude for those who served, and renewed commitment to building communities shaped by mercy rather than resentment and hope rather than fear.

Twenty-five years have passed, but remembrance remains.

We will never forget. And as Christians, may we also never forget our calling to love, to pray, to serve, and to be instruments of God's peace.
